- y0av: hey, I'm arguing with someone about something related to team playstyles (on which playstyle is bulkier), so to help me, would you please tell me if my next message is true?
- ACakeWearingAHat: ok
- y0av: bulky offense is a kind of offense that utilizes pivots, most of the time defensive ones (usually 2-3) to help with common attackers, while using attackers of many kinds to take down the opposing team,
- ACakeWearingAHat: nah
- y0av: wait what
- y0av: when I say defensive pivots I mean defensive checks to common attackers that don't always have recovery
- ACakeWearingAHat: bulky offense is just 6 mons that have at least some offensive presence but there is defensive synergy within it and there are switchins to shit
- ACakeWearingAHat: bulky offense does not have passive mons
- ACakeWearingAHat: generally
- y0av: oh that's sort of what I meant, yeah
- ACakeWearingAHat: balance has passive walls
- ACakeWearingAHat: bo doesn't
- y0av: balance basically is a team with a defensive core that is less passive than stall pokemon, and uses 1-2 breakers to help take down bulky playstyles and actually get damage done and a revenge killer/speed control to help beat opposing attackers (mostly sweepers) ?
- ACakeWearingAHat: doesn't have to be that formulaic
- ACakeWearingAHat: balance just has a balance of offense and defense
- ACakeWearingAHat: simple as that
- y0av: while BO basically is an offensive team with defensive synergy and switches to "shit", right?
- ACakeWearingAHat: ya
